Léo Coly selected to prepare for the 6 Nations Tournament

The 6 Nations Tournament is fast approaching. This Sunday evening, 42 players from the XV of France arrive in Aubagne in Provence-Alpes-Côte d’Azur to prepare for the first match of the Blues against Italy. Among them, Leo Coly, scrum-half for Stade Montois. It’s here third time that the 22-year-old Pro D2 player puts on the tricolor cleats for training.

Coach Fabien Galthié had to deal with the package of 9 players, injured or positive for Covid-19. Stade Toulousain stars Antoine Dupont and Romain Ntamack are among the notable absentees.

The Six Nations tournament begins on Saturday February 5 with the match between Ireland and Wales at 3:15 p.m. The first match of the blues will take place at the Stade de France, next Sunday, February 6.
